Comprehending the Risks of Money Laundering:

One of the substantial risks related to online betting is its potential usage for money laundering. Due to the nature of the deals, which can be large and regular, betting platforms can be exploited by people aiming to obscure the origins of illicit funds. Online betting sites operate in a digital realm where transactions are finished within seconds, frequently without the strenuous checks discovered in standard financial institutions. This environment can unfortunately function as an efficient medium for cleaning dirty money.

The Reality of Scam Sites:

Fraud sites are a continuous issue in the online betting market. These platforms mimic genuine betting websites, offering too-good-to-be-true promos to lure unwary users. As soon as engaged, users may discover that their deposits are taken without any possibility of winning or withdrawing funds. Recognizing and avoiding fraud sites is important for anybody involved in online betting. Indications of possible scams consist of absence of licensing info, bad reviews from other users, and generic or badly built web design.

Promoting Safer Online Betting Practices:

To mitigate the dangers connected with online betting, it is vital to adopt much safer betting practices:

1. Select Licensed and Regulated Sites: Always engage with betting websites that are licensed and regulated by credible authorities. These websites are required to follow stringent guidelines that secure users from scams and ensure fair play.

2. Read Reviews and Testimonials: Before dedicating to any betting platform, checked out evaluations and testimonials from other users. These can provide insight into the reliability and stability of the website.

3. Usage Secure Payment Methods: Opt for secure payment methods that provide scams security. Prevent utilizing direct bank transfers or credit cards unless you are sure of the site's security steps.

4. Set Spending Limits: Responsible betting involves setting stringent costs limitations. The majority of reputable sites offer tools to help users control their betting practices, money laundring avoiding spontaneous and possibly damaging costs.

5. Watch Out For Promotions: While promos can boost the betting experience, they can likewise be deceptive. Evaluate every offer carefully and read the terms and conditions.
